Lee Si-young
Lee Si-young, originally named Lee Eun-rae, was born on April 17, 1982, in Cheongwon County, North Chungcheong Province, South Korea. At the age of nine, her family relocated to Seoul, where she would eventually pursue a degree in Fashion Design at Dongduk Women's University. In her journey as an artist, she adopted the stage name Lee Si-young.

In addition to her acting career, Lee Si-young is also an accomplished amateur boxer. She has embraced the sport with dedication and has participated in various competitions, earning respect both in the boxing ring and on screen.
